import sys
if __name__ == '__main__':
sys.stdout.write("STDOUT\n")
sys.stderr.write("STDERR\n")
Не могли бы вы объяснить, почему, когда я пишу в stderr, я вижу вывод STDERR на стандартный вывод? Я предполагал, что в терминале должен быть виден только STDOUT.
$ python stdout_stdin.py
STDOUT
STDERR
Подробнее здесь: https://stackoverflow.com/questions/335 ... the-stdout
Почему, когда я пишу в stderr, я вижу вывод STDERR на стандартном выводе? ⇐ Python
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ение